Abstract
Three-dimensional hat-shaped alignments of carbon nanotubes were prepared by pyrolysis of iron(II) phthalocyanine on aluminium-coated silica substrates at 950°C in an Ar/H2 flow. The possible formation mechanism of the structure has also been discussed.
